How to Make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ars:
Step 1: Preheat Your Oven
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). While it warms up, grab an 8×8-inch baking dish and grease it with nonstick cooking spray or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.
Step 2: Prepare the Crust
In a medium bowl, combine melted butter with sugar and flour until crumbly. Press this mixture evenly into the bottom of your prepared baking dish. Bake for about 10 minutes until lightly golden.
Step 3: Make the Cream Cheese Filling
In another bowl, beat together softened cream cheese, s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ract until smooth and creamy. This is where all that dreamy texture comes from!
Step 4: Add Blueberries
Gently fold in those beautiful fresh blueberries into your cream cheese mixture. Try not to crush them; we want whole berries bursting with flavor!
Step 5: Combine Layers
Pour the blueberry cream cheese filling over the pre-baked crust. Spread it out evenly with a spatula so every bite will be packed with flavor.
Step 6: Bake Until Set
Bake in your preheated oven for about 25-30 minutes or until the center is set but still slightly jiggly—like that friend who can’t stop dancing at weddings!

Storing & Reheating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ars
Store leftover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week. For reheating, pop them in the microwave for about 10-15 seconds or enjoy them cold straight from the fridge.

How do you store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ars?
To store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ars, place them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They can stay fresh for up to five days when properly stored. If you want to keep them longer, consider freezing them. Wrap each bar individually in plastic wrap and then place them in a freezer-safe container. They can last for about three months in the freezer. When you’re ready to eat them, simply thaw in the refrigerator overnight before serving.
Can I substitute other fruits in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ars?
Yes, you can absolutely substitute other fruits in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ars! While blueberries add a wonderful flavor and color, feel free to experiment with raspberries, strawberries, or even peaches. Just ensure that the fruit is ripe and sweet for the best results. Adjust the sugar level as needed based on the sweetness of your chosen fruit. This flexibility allows you to create variations that suit your taste preferences or seasonal availability.
Are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ars suitable for special diets?
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ars can be modified to suit various dietary needs. For gluten-free options, use almond flour or gluten-free all-purpose flour for the crust. If you’re looking for a lower-calorie version, consider using light cream cheese or Greek yogurt as a substitute for regular cream cheese. Additionally, you can replace granulated sugar with natural sweeteners like honey or maple syrup if desired. Always check ingredient labels to ensure they meet your dietary requirements.

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 45 minutes
- Yield: Approximately 12 servings 1x
- Category: Dessert
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
Description
Blueberry Cream Cheese Bars are a delightful dessert that combines a creamy filling with juicy blueberries, all on a buttery crust. These bars strike the perfect balance between sweet and tangy, making them an irresistible treat for any occasion. Ideal for brunch or as an afternoon snack, their vibrant flavor and beautiful presentation will impress family and friends alike.
Ingredients
- 1 cup fresh blueberries (about 150g)
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ar (200g)
- 1 cup all-purpose flour (120g)
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ted (113g)
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ease an 8×8-inch baking dish or line it with parchment paper.
- In a medium bowl, mix melted butter with sugar and flour until crumbly. Press evenly into the bottom of the prepared dish and bake for about 10 minutes until lightly golden.
- In another bowl, beat cream cheese with sugar, eggs, and vanilla until smooth. Gently fold in blueberries.
- Pour blueberry filling over the crust and spread evenly. Bake for 25-30 minutes until center is set but slightly jiggly.
- Allow to cool completely before slicing into bars.
